gentle stress
Song Information
Artist: DJ Swan
Composition/Arrangement: Keiichi Ueno, Toshiaki Komiya
BPM: 174
Length: 1:43
Genre: DRUM & BASS
VJ: ?
First Music Game Appearance: beatmania IIDX substream
Other Music Game Appearances:
- beatmania THE FINAL / beatmania III THE FINAL
- DanceDanceRevolution 2ndMIX CLUB VERSION 2

Song Connections / Remixes
- A remix of gentle stress by MR.DOG, titled gentle stress (AMD SEXUAL MIX), can be found in DanceDanceRevolution 3rdMIX. The remix name was changed to "(SENSUAL MIX)" for US releases and from SuperNOVA until its removal.
- According to the DanceDanceRevolution X3 VS 2ndMIX master songlist, the remix name would've been reverted to its original one.
- A "live" long version of gentle stress, titled gentle stress(Live@honeyhunter TKO ’08) appears on Keiichi Ueno's first album, Rewind!.
- A remix of gentle stress by fu_mou, titled gentle stress wobble rmx, can be found in SOUND VOLTEX BOOTH.
Trivia
- gentle stress marks the debut of Toshiaki Komiya on the beatmania IIDX series.
- According to Keiichi Ueno's song comments on Secret of Love, dj TAKA was the one who came up with the name "gentle stress" for the song.
- gentle stress' overlays are used as generic animations in beatmania THE FINAL.
- Appropriately, they are used several times in gentle stress' animations.
Music Production Information
beatmania THE FINAL
Commentary by Fujii:
A port from IIDX SUBSTREAM. The format of the this song is, at its core, a soup containing drum and bass mixed with the beautiful, flowing melody of a piano. It feels like we're riding through an era of early drum'n'bass.
